Overview

Savannah College of Art and Design (SCAD) offers a Bachelor of Arts in Advertising, which is a four-year program. The tuition fee for this course is $40,595. To get admitted into the Bachelor of Arts in Advertising at SCAD, students need to show their English language skills. Accepted tests include IELTS, TOEFL, and PTE.

Key Insights

  • list items The friendly atmosphere at an art and design university is perfect for improving skills in creative advertising.
  • list items Students will learn all parts of advertising, including writing, art direction, digital production, and brand marketing.
  • list items With SCADpro, the university's own design studio, advertising students work on projects for big names like AT&T, BMW, Google, L'Oréal, and Mercedes-Benz. This prepares them for real-world campaigns with famous brands.
  • list items This modern way of learning about advertising helps students become flexible storytellers across different platforms. They can choose from various careers like art direction, writing, creative technology, brand experiences, and consumer engagement strategies, focusing on digital production, typography, and social media content creation.

    Application Process

    Step One: Prepare Documents for Application

    Statement of Purpose (SOP)

    The SOP should be no more than 500 words. It should summarize your academic and personal experiences, showing your preparation and commitment to studying at Savannah College of Art and Design (SCAD). Include your educational and professional goals.

    Letters of Recommendation (LOR)

    You may submit one to three letters of recommendation from professors, teachers, counselors, or community leaders who know you well. These recommendations should highlight your commitment and qualities such as creativity, initiative, motivation, character, and academic success. This will help assess your potential as a student at SCAD.

    Step Two: Additional Documents Required

    • list items An official transcript or mark sheet from your last high school or secondary school, showing all years of grades and proof of graduation.
    • list items English Language Proficiency (ELP) scores.
    • list items Proof of medical insurance.
    • list items A portfolio, audition, riding, or writing submission, scored according to specific criteria (recommended).
    • list items A copy of the first page of your passport if you are an international applicant.
    • list items A copy of the first page of the passport for any dependent traveling with you.
    • list items A portfolio or resume listing your achievements. This can include extracurricular activities, awards, community service, volunteer work, leadership roles, work experience, and other relevant accomplishments (recommended).

    Step Three: Start Your Online Application

    Begin your application by following the online process provided by SCAD.

    Step Four: Application Fees for This Course

    The application fee is USD 100, which is approximately INR 8.43 Thousand.

    Payment methods include credit card, debit card, or wire transfer.

    SCAD accepts Flywire and PayMyTuition for international payments. These services offer good foreign exchange rates, allow you to pay in your home currency in many cases, and save money compared to traditional bank transfers.
